Tolland Lacrosse Club is a member club of USA Lacrosse. Our Boys' teams are additionally members of Connecticut Valley Youth Lacrosse (CVYL). As such, our boys' programs follow the rules and development guidelines of USA Lacrosse and CVYL.

 

Season

The primary season for lacrosse is in the spring and typically runs from late March or early April through June. In addition to the spring season, some summer and fall programs are also available for Bantam, Junior and Senior lacrosse.

 

Teams

Both experienced and new-to-lacrosse players are welcome at every age level of our Tolland Youth Lacrosse teams. Our team placement aligns with USA Lacrosse age group guidelines (https://www.usalacrosse.com/age-eligibility-guidelines ), placing boys within the following teams:

Lightning* - Grades 1, 2, and some K

*TLC Lightning players are typically in 1st and 2nd grade and fall within the USA Lacrosse 7U & 8U groupings. Some players who are 6U by USA Lacrosse age grouping or are in kindergarten may participate. It is recommended that parents who are unsure if their child is ready reach out to our club president (contact found under Board of Directors tab) to help make a decision.

Bantam - Grades 3 and 4

Juniors - Grades 5 and 6

Seniors - Grades 7 and 8**

**Seniors may also include 8th grade boys who are outside of the USL 14U age range.

 Boys Lightning Lacrosse

 The Tolland Lightning Lacrosse Program is designed to introduce newer players to the sport of lacrosse in a fun environment that focuses on the development of fundamental lacrosse skills and teamwork. The Lightning team will meet twice a week; one weeknight for practice and one weekend day for either a game or practice. We use age appropriate drills and games in an effort to teach players how to scoop through and pick up ground balls, pass, catch and shoot. As our players develop their skills, we scrimmage within our team and play friendly games with other Lightning Programs. The team plays 6 to 8 games over the course of the season. There is some travel involved with the Lightning program as we do play games with other Lightning Programs in our area.

 Boys Bantam, Junior & Senior Lacrosse

Both experienced and new-to-lacrosse players are welcome on all teams.

 Practices & Games: In the Spring season, Bantam, Junior and Senior teams typically practice 2 times per week, with one or two games per week. Boys Bantam, Junior and Seniors teams are considered travel teams, with Bantam traveling somewhat less through Seniors traveling somewhat more.

Playoffs and Championship: As a member of CVYL each Boys Junior and Senior team has an opportunity to play in CVYL playoffs and advance to the championships. These games occur in June and take place after regular season games are complete.

Tournaments: Depending on availability, our Boys Bantam, Junior and Seniors teams typically participate in at least one tournament each season. Some seasons teams are able to participate in more than one tournament.

Team Size: Teams may be limited in size so that everyone gets sufficient playing time and coaches can successfully manage practices. Additional teams at each level may be added if there are sufficient registrations and volunteers to coach. Depending on the number of registrants, boys playing in Juniors and Seniors will be placed on A and B teams based on skill level.
